I am using the LabView to remotely perform a measurement on 3458A. I see the measurement result returned back correct but the STB status also indicates error. From the instrument front panel, I checked the error which indicates "107, Memory Empty" error. I wonder what this error mean? And, is there anything that I can do to get rid of this error?

I would have to see your program. Or an NI I/O trace so I can see what commands are actually being sent to the instrument.
Normally you would get this message if an RMEM command was sent to the instrument and there are no readings in memory.
I assume you are using the 3458A driver? If yes, then it is sending a lot of commands to the instrument you may not be aware of, thus I would need to get a copy of your program, or an NI I/O trace that was recording while your program was running.
